Why SimTek® Fencing is a Wise Choice in South Florida

With all the different types of fencing material available, it can be extremely difficult for home and business owners to decide what best meets their needs. It’s a common problem, as individuals try to balance their need for safety, privacy and materials that will withstand the severe weather conditions that often assail the South Florida landscape.

One very wise choice is SimTek® fencing that accommodates a wide variety of requirements. It’s a type of molded polyethylene that offers an extensive array of benefits that includes durability combined with a myriad of beautiful and realistic-looking surfaces that emulate stone and wood.

Hurricane Winds

South Florida is subject to storms with strong winds, the fiercest of which are hurricanes. SimTek® fencing is reinforced with galvanized steel making it able to withstand sustained hurricane winds of up to 110 mph and gusts up to 130 mph. It’s one of the only vinyl fencing materials that meet the Miami-Dade wind load requirements without any modification to its construction or installation.

Environmentally Friendly

SimTek® panels are constructed with recycled materials. When the fencing eventually reaches the end of its long lifespan, each of the panels can be recycled in its turn.

Sun and Surf

The UV rays of the sun are strong in South Florida and it can add environmental aging to most materials. SimTek® doesn’t have that problem. It’s unaffected by the harsh rays of the sun and won’t deteriorate. The same is true of the fencing for ocean salt spray, along with algae and most chemicals routinely used around home and businesses. It’s an ideal choice for any oceanside property. Alkaline and acidic soils have little effect on the fencing and owners don’t have to worry about termites and other insect pests.

High Durability

A SimTek® fence provides superior performance in a wide variety of climate conditions without fading and will stand up to impacts without taking damage. It won’t warp or crack.

Very Low Maintenance

SimTek® fencing is resistant to graffiti and it only takes a high-pressure rinse to remove marks. Dust just rinses off and there’s no other maintenance required. It never needs staining or painting.

Commercial Fencing Options

Fencing in commercial venues can take many forms, from temporary fencing on job projects to high-tech security around warehouses. There are multiple types of materials from which to choose that will accommodate very specific needs.

Hiding Unattractive Features

Dumpsters, generators and electrical boxes are just some of the items that can be found in and around home developments, warehouses, factories, stores, and restaurants. They’re unsightly and can attract unwelcome wildlife. One of the most popular options for camouflaging and containing those areas is wooden fencing. PVC and SimTek® are also excellent choices. The options come in a variety of styles, colors, textures and won’t attract insects.

High Security

Whether it’s a wild animal enclosure, food processing plant or correctional facility, high-security fencing is typically an incarnation chain link. It’s available in multiple-size weaves, can be erected in multiple heights, and spikes or razor wire can be affixed to the top. The fencing is equally applicable for facilities ranging from airports and shipyards to chemical plants.

Large Gates

A fence isn’t complete without a gate and there are several types that can be paired with commercial fencing that open vertically or horizontally. Commercial endeavors can select from sliding and bi-folding styles, vertical lift or pivot gates, and those that require a keycard or keypad to gain entry.

Temporary

Chain link fencing is the undisputed king for creating temporary barriers and barricades. The material is cost-effective and installs quickly to secure expensive tools and vehicles on construction sites and protect companies from liability. 

The fences are also effective in areas where commercial remodeling or landscaping is being performed. The fencing can be used on uneven terrain that could be dangerous to people. Two added benefits with temporary chain link fencing are that a tarp or other material can be easily affixed to the fencing to prevent prying eyes from seeing inside and the fence covering aids in keeping down dust.

Things to Consider Before Fencing in the Yard

A fenced-in yard has aesthetic appeal and can provide an important safety enhancement. However, there are any number of reasons that you may want to install a fence or you may have multiple reasons. It’s essential that you know what purpose the fence will serve before contacting a professional. That knowledge will help you choose the type of fencing, the optimal materials for your specific needs, and get an idea of the cost.

Reason for the Fence

It doesn’t matter whether you’re living on a farm or in suburbia, before you can choose fencing that accommodates your requirements, you’ll need to know why you need or want the fence. Common reasons include establishing safe boundaries for children and pets or to deny access to stray animals and wildlife.

You may want a fence to create a more secure environment, for purely decorative purposes to enhance visual appeal, or establish boundaries with neighbors. Once you determine why you want or need a fence, you can move on to other considerations.

Cost

The cost of fencing varies widely depending on the area to be fenced and the materials chosen. You have multiple options encompassing chain link, wood, aluminum, PVC and SimTek®.

Maintenance Requirements

If you’re not fond of the thought of making regular fence inspections, arduous cleaning tasks, painting or other maintenance chores, there’s a fencing material for you. Conversely, if you have plenty of time and don’t mind spraying for insects, staining or waterproofing your fence, there are also options.

Climate Considerations

The climate in South Florida can be unkind to certain types of fencing materials due to varying weather and climate conditions. Fencing is available that won’t burn should a fire occur and is especially beneficial if you live in an area at risk for forest fires. You can choose eco-friendly fencing materials, those that won’t warp or deteriorate under the sun’s UV rays, and even materials that can withstand hurricane-force winds.

Be Neighborly

You’ll definitely want to talk with neighbors before erecting a fence. Depending on the prevailing rules and regulations, they may be responsible for a portion of the upkeep. You also don’t want to install a fence that intrudes on their pristine view.

Don’t Mess with the HOA

For individuals that want a more regimented approach to their community, a house covered by a home owner’s association (HOA) offers a number of benefits. They can provide amenities, a means of controlling property values, and they may take care of chores such as mowing. An HOA also comes with a variety of rules and regulations.

HOAs are very meticulous about their guidelines and have no problem enforcing them which can result in a hefty fine. It’s critical that individuals know the rules in their community before erecting a fence or making any major changes that have the potential of running afoul of the HOA. Always obtain written HOA approval before initiating any changes.

Fencing

There will be rules governing the height of a fence, the type of materials that are acceptable for use, and even regulations as to if you can install a fence at all. You could face fines for every day that the fence violates HOA rules or you could be forced to move it, alter it, or completely take it down.

Paint

If you’re looking to add a little distinction with a colorful new door or other outwardly visible change – think again. HOAs view violations of conformity, appearance, overall style and aesthetics very seriously.

Holiday Decorations

Another common area in which HOAs regulate the environment is through holiday decorations. An HOA will have guidelines for when holiday decorations can go up, when they must be taken down, and the type of decorations that are allowable. The HOA will determine the hours during which the lights can be operated and sound levels for animated or inflatable decorations.

Pets and People

The breed, size and number of pets allowed will be strictly enforced, while some HOAs ban pets of any kind. There will also be restrictions in place as to the number of people that can occupy a home and the length of time that someone can stay for an extended visit.

Other Guidelines

HOAs typically have rules about where trash receptacles can be stored, their placement when it’s time for trash pick-up, how long they can be left in sight, and recycling. If you live in an HOA, there will be regulations about where you can park vehicles and a pass may need to be requested for visitors. Don’t forget to keep up the HOAs maintenance standards on your home and fence.

Fence and Gate Safety

A fence is an excellent way to ensure the safety of children and pets, keep stray animals and wildlife out, and discourage would-be intruders. One of the keys to safety and security is the proper gate, but the installation of a gate also comes with the need for gate safety. Gates can be installed that use a traditional key, swipe card, remote control or touchpad.

A gate needs to be locked if it’s to perform its function of keeping people and wildlife out while maintaining safe boundaries for children and pets. However, care must be taken to ensure young children can’t reach the locking mechanism or have access to the key. That consideration is even more important if the fence surrounds a swimming pool.

It’s essential that individuals always make sure the gate is securely closed, locked, and that older children understand the importance of maintaining gate safety. Even the most high-tech fence and gate won’t keep people or pets in and intruders out if it’s not closed and locked. One solution is automatically locking gates.

Gates should be installed at the same height as the fencing to ensure they perform the function for which they were designed. A gate that’s too short or tall will also mar the aesthetics of the fence and home.

Always install a lock on the inside of the gate that can’t be accessed from outside. It will need to be high enough that children can’t reach it or climb up for access. Another consideration are pets. Depending upon the type of lock involved, large dogs can accidentally open some types of gates if they jump up – and don’t ever assume that the family pet can’t learn how to open a gate.

A gate and lock are essential elements for any fence to ensure safety. Self-closing and latching gates are great for fencing around the entire yard. They’re critical if the fence surrounds a swimming pool. Gate safety should never be taken for granted.

Why an Aluminum Fence Might be Best for your Yard

Individuals have multiple fencing materials from which to choose and it will be difficult to make a decision. While most people opt for newer materials, there are times when tried and tested aluminum fencing may be the best option for your yard. Aluminum has a variety of benefits that tend to get overlooked.

Affordable

The cost of aluminum fencing makes it a very affordable option and provides an excellent return on investment since it has a significant lifespan. A properly installed aluminum fence can last for up to 50 years.

Appearance

Aluminum is available in multiple colors, styles and can be customized in a variety of ways. It can even be painted, but the most popular color choice is black due to its clean lines and elegant look. The material can be fashioned to look like high-end wrought iron.

Durability

Aluminum fencing is highly durable since it doesn’t oxidize and rust like iron. Aluminum doesn’t warp, crack, chip, flake or rot. The material is extremely unappealing to insects.

Maintenance

Minimal maintenance is a feature of aluminum fencing. A scrub down with soapy water and a brush, combined with a rinse with the garden hose, is all that’s needed to keep aluminum fencing looking like new.

Security and Safety

If you have children or pets, aluminum fencing is an excellent solution for keeping them safe and within the boundary of the yard. Panels can be added for an extra layer of protection for very small children and diminutive pets. The fencing keeps stray animals and wildlife from entering and is a strong deterrent to would-be human intruders. It’s easy to install multiple types of security gates to aluminum fencing.

Value and Insurance

Aluminum fencing adds value to properties and it can help you save in other ways. Many insurance companies offer discounts or better rates on policies for properties protected by fencing.

Versatility

The fencing can be utilized in a variety of ways and enables you to see beyond the yard’s confines if you desire. Bushes and shrubbery can be planted to block the view if you prefer. The fencing also has benefits if you like to garden. You can plant flowers against the fence and let them drape artfully against the barrier or let vines twine among the rails.

Privacy is a Major Factor when Choosing a Fence

A fence can be installed to meet an extensive number of needs, but the No. 1 reason is typically to obtain an enhanced level of privacy. There are numerous reasons why a fence for privacy makes sense and there are multiple materials from which to choose.

Homes are being built closer together, making it even more difficult to enjoy family activities away from prying eyes. Fencing also provides a safer haven for children to play without coming to the attention of the unscrupulous. Certain types of pets are at an elevated risk of being stolen. A privacy fence is also a good idea to keep valuable equipment and recreational aspects from sight.

How Much Privacy?

A major consideration before erecting a fence is how much privacy is desired. Individuals that want to be able to still see their surroundings on the other side of the fence can choose one with alternating panels. Those that want complete privacy to sunbathe or let children and pets roam the property safe from the eyes of others will want to install a solid fence.

Fence Height

The height of the barrier will depend on several criteria. There may be local ordinances that preclude placing a fence at the desired height. Those living in close proximity to other homes won’t have the same amount of privacy if the house next door is a two-story structure.

Conversely, a fence won’t stop people from cutting across the property, picking prize roses, or stray animals from coming on the property if the fence isn’t high enough. Individuals may also need to obtain the approval of neighbors that directly adjoin the property. Before installing a fence, it’s best to check local zoning and ordinances.

Maintenance

Some fences aren’t a “one-and-done” solution. They require regular inspection and maintenance if they’re to serve their purpose. Wood will need to be painted or stained to prevent weathering and the material is attractive to insects. There are newer fencing materials that can withstand hurricane-force winds and simply need to be rinsed down with a hose to keep their good looks while providing multiple privacy options.

8 Things to Consider when Choosing a Fence

Fences are multi-faceted constructs that provide safety, security, are capable of dampening road noise, and can camouflaging a variety of eyesores within the landscape. The type of fencing selected will depend on the property owner’s primary concerns, needs and requirements. The following are eight things to consider when choosing a fence.

Children

Every parent knows how curious children are and how they can stray into danger unknowingly. A fence is an excellent way to ensure they don’t wander out of the yard or near dangerous areas. It shouldn’t have any protrusions that they can use to climb or spaces underneath they can crawl under.

Pets

Animal companions are family members, too. They’re just as curious as children and can be tempted to leave their yard to explore. Fences should be erected with the size of the animal in mind and its characteristics. Some dogs are jumpers and acrobats, well able to clear a fence of 10 ft. and use any protrusions in the fence to gain a toe-hold. Others are more likely to burrow underneath and fencing will need to provide adequate preventative measures installed. 

Pools

Anyone that has a swimming pool is required to install safety fencing to prevent unauthorized access by children that meets specific guidelines. It must have no protrusions that children can use to climb over it and be close enough to the ground to prevent crawling under it. The fence will also need an automatically locking gate. Those precautions will also save pets from entering and drowning.

Property Lines

Sometimes it’s necessary to establish boundaries between neighbors or even prevent passersby from coming on the property. A fence is beneficial for minimizing disagreements with neighbors and knowing where to place outbuildings, install a pool, or locate play equipment.

Privacy

Finding privacy is getting more difficult every day. More homes are being squeezed into smaller properties and foot traffic on sidewalks is increasing. Fencing can ensure the ability to sunbathe or use a pool in peace and away from nosy neighbors.

Enhance Landscaping

A fence enhances landscaping, adds curb appeal to any property, and increases resale value. A property with a fence is more private and safer than an open yard.

Safety

The installation of a fence for safety and security has quickly become two of the top reasons for erecting a barrier around properties. It keeps people, pets and possessions safe from those that would mean harm.

Concealment

There are multiple items that are essentials for everyday life, but aren’t that pretty to view. Fencing is also an attractive way to hide and camouflage unsightly items in the landscape such as trash receptacles, utility boxes, air conditioning units, and TV or Internet dishes, along with hoses and PVC pipes.

Exotic Pet Fence Enclosures

Florida is home to a great diversity of animals and it’s also legal to keep a variety of exotic animals, provided individuals obtain the proper class of permit that’s determined by the state. Owning an exotic animal comes with the responsibility to provide it with appropriate living conditions. To accomplish that, a fence is often required to ensure the safety of people and the animal.

Mental and Physical Benefits

Fenced enclosures provide a variety of mental and physical benefits for the animals. Trying to keep even smaller exotic pets cooped up in a home without enough room to exercise is bad for their mental and emotional health. Being able to move around through the use of a fenced-in area aids in preventing mental and emotional issues.

In the wild, much of the animals’ energy goes into hunting and surviving. When kept in a domestic environment, they have enough to eat and don’t have to hunt. That energy may often be channeled into undesirable mischief if they don’t get enough exercise. A fenced enclosure enables exotic pets to obtain the exercise they need to aid in warding off undesirable behaviors.

Type of Enclosure

The type of enclosure required for an exotic animal can vary widely depending on the animal. Shy animals and those that are easily upset may need a solid fence to prevent anxiety problems. Some exotics are climbers or fliers and any fencing option will need to include a mesh canopy over the top to keep them contained.

For those that dig and root in the soil, there are specialized fencing options with underground cables. Some exotic animals are excellent jumpers. Fencing is available in multiple heights that can be installed to discourage even the most accomplished jumpers.
